site stats

Free-knot splines

WebMay 2, 2024 · freeknotsplines: Algorithms for Implementing Free-Knot Splines Algorithms for fitting free-knot splines for data with one independent variable and one dependent …

freeknotsplines package - RDocumentation

WebOriginally, spline was a term for elastic rulers that were bent to pass through a number of predefined points, or knots. These were used to make technical drawings for shipbuilding and construction by hand, as illustrated in the figure. We wish to model similar kinds of curves using a set of mathematical equations. WebAlgorithms for fitting free-knot splines for data with one independent variable and one dependent variable. Four free-knot spline algorithms are provided for the case where … griffin waste https://mgcidaho.com

Spline interpolation - Wikipedia

WebLine To Line Knot. Leader Knots and Knots that you can use to tie one fishing line to another line. The Blood Knot is tried and true and a long time favorite with fishermen. … WebThe approach is to first remove the hooks of the strokes by using changed-angle threshold with length threshold, then filter the noise by using a smoothing technique, which is the combination of the cubic spline and the equal-interpolation … WebHi, First of all, thanks for this fantastic package. At the moment, I'm working with splines2::PeriodicMSpline. Following the docs there is a method set_knot_sequence and I assumed that this can be... fifa buy ronaldo

Approximation and estimation bounds for free knot splines

Category:fit.search.numknots: Perform a Search on the Number of Knots …

Tags:Free-knot splines

Free-knot splines

Spline (mathematics) - Wikipedia

WebJan 1, 2024 · With knot number being free, the Lasso-based heuristic method by Yuan et al. (2013) chooses 6 interior knots from a 8-level multi-resolution B-spline basis function … WebCompared with DCB-splines, our splines can generate visually pleasant surfaces with smaller fitting errors by using the same number of knots and iterations. With almost the same number of control points, our framework produces more accurate and visually pleasant results than the classical B-spline surface fitting method based on adaptive …

Free-knot splines

Did you know?

WebA free-knot spline is a spline where the knot locations are considered parameters to be estimated from the data. Freeing the knots improves the spline's approximating power … WebFeb 24, 2024 · Free-knot-spline-approximation. The purpose of this function is to provide a flexible and robust fit to one-dimensional data using free-knot splines. The knots are …

WebApr 1, 2024 · A Data-Reduction Strategy for Splines with Applications to the Approximation of Functions and Data Article Full-text available Apr 1988 Tom Lyche View Show abstract Cubic Spline Data Reduction... In mathematics, a spline is a special function defined piecewise by polynomials. In interpolating problems, spline interpolation is often preferred to polynomial interpolation because it yields similar results, even when using low degree polynomials, while avoiding Runge's phenomenon for higher … See more The term "spline" is used to refer to a wide class of functions that are used in applications requiring data interpolation and/or smoothing. The data may be either one-dimensional or multi-dimensional. Spline functions for … See more We begin by limiting our discussion to polynomials in one variable. In this case, a spline is a piecewise polynomial function. This function, call it … See more It might be asked what meaning more than n multiple knots in a knot vector have, since this would lead to continuities like at the location of … See more For a given interval [a,b] and a given extended knot vector on that interval, the splines of degree n form a vector space. Briefly this means that adding any two splines of a given type produces spline of that given type, and multiplying a spline of a given type by any … See more Suppose the interval [a,b] is [0,3] and the subintervals are [0,1], [1,2], and [2,3]. Suppose the polynomial pieces are to be of degree 2, and the pieces on [0,1] and [1,2] must join in … See more The general expression for the ith C interpolating cubic spline at a point x with the natural condition can be found using the formula See more Before computers were used, numerical calculations were done by hand. Although piecewise-defined functions like the sign function or step function were used, polynomials were … See more

WebAB - This article proposes a function estimation procedure using free-knot splines as well as an associated algorithm for implementation in nonparametric regression. In contrast to … WebApr 11, 2024 · Semiparametric modeling techniques, such as generalized additive models (GAM), employ thin-plate splines to generate a basis expansion on the distances between spatial grid cells and knots placed over the study area to generate a smoothing matrix comparable to a GAM smooth that can account for the random effects of spatial …

WebMar 20, 2024 · 3.2 Free knots placement. There are various approaches to identify a knot vector for a B-spline fitting. In this paper, we employ bisecting method for determining …

WebSep 6, 2024 · We develop a Bayesian free-knot splines approach to approximate the nonparametric functions. It can be performed to facilitate efficient Markov chain Monte … fifa buy player tWebHow to put fitting constraints on smoothing splines. Having a curve as the one shown in the image, and knowing for sure that the peak of this curve is the blue point, we would like to reconstruct it such that it has its peak at the blue point, so. I did some fitting for it using smoothing splines through the curve fiiting toolbox, and with ... fifa buy 2022 world cup ticketsWebSplines (scikit-learn) Note that spline transformers are a new feature in scikit learn 1.0. Therefore, make sure to use the latest version of scikit learn. Use conda list scikit-learn … fifa bxhWebFeb 24, 2024 · The purpose of this function is to provide a flexible and robust fit to one-dimensional data using free-knot splines. The knots are free and able to cope with … griffin waste services charlotteWebSep 6, 2024 · If your data are non-uniformly distributed along re_month you might want to try specifying just the number of knots and let ns () pick the knot locations itself. you should really check for overdispersion, and (if necessary) use either (1) an observation-level random effect (2) lme4::glmer.nb or (3) glmmTMB griffin waste services asheville ncWebOct 25, 2024 · Splines are simply parts of the whole polynomial line. The line is split into few knots where every two knots are connected by a polynomial line which is determined by the user. This essentially eliminates the influence of a single data point on the global polynomial curve. Pythonic Implementation fifa buy playersWebDec 1, 2001 · We describe a Bayesian method, for fitting curves to data drawn from an exponential family, that uses splines for which the number and locations of knots are free parameters. The method uses reversible jump Markov chain Monte Carlo to change the knot configurations and a locality heuristic to speed up mixing. griffin waste services